The world needs

to be wrapped

in warmed up fleece

allowing the softness

to envelop,

the warmth to permeate

and infiltrate

But not to pull

over our eyes,

For we need to see the

ignorantly-formed

intentions of those

who seek to control

us

to avoid the

fleecing of our

collective joy.

Let this warm softness

be our bond,

our protection and

connection

nurturing and

growing

our fierce will

to thrive

in community

and evade

the temptation

for complacently

neutral

immunity.
